Explain the role of transpiration.
संक्षेप में उत्तर
Advertisements
उत्तर
Role of transpiration:
- It removes excess of water.
- It helps in the passive absorption of water and minerals from the soil.
- It helps in the ascent of sap.
- As stomata are open, gaseous exchange required for photosynthesis and respiration is facilitated.
- It maintains the turgor of the cells.
- Transpiration helps in reducing the temperature of leaf and in imparting a cooling effect.
